Congratulations to our sister Tishaura O. Jones (@tishaura) for making history as the first Black woman to be elected as the mayor of St. Louis, Missouri.
Soror Jones was initiated in 1999 & is a member of Saint Louis Metropolitan Alumnae.

Judge Lisa White Hardwick is the first Black woman to serve as an appellate court judge in Missouri’s state history. She joined Epsilon Psi at the University of Missouri-Columbia and currently serves the Kansas City Missouri Alumnae Chapter. #DSTSheroes#WomensHistoryMonth
